HP made sure not to skimp out on their all-in-one Pavilion PC line as well as they made sure to give them the proper attention.  Now w/ a more contemporary design and bells + whistles to keep up w/ today standards & technology.  

The new all-in-ones will arrive in a 23.8inch & 27inch size w/ a choice of an edge-to-edge or micro edge display.  You have the option of 1080p HD or QHD resolutions w/ a choice of touchscreen or nah.  Inside they’re powered by either an Intel Pentium or Core i7 w/ option for NVIDIA or AMD GPU, up to 16GB of RAM, choice of 3TB or up to 1TB hybrid drive, dual front-facing speakers powered by B&O Play, 2 USB 3.0, 2 USB 2.0, 1 LAN, HDMI out, 3-in-1 card reader, and headphone/mic jack.

You also have the option to add an optical drive for those of you who still require a CD/DVD drive in your life.  Select all-in-one models offer an HP Privacy Camera which is a webcam that pops up out of the top of the monitor via a spring mechanism.  Ideal for those of you concerned about your webcam being hacked and being spied on.   And lastly, you have the option for an Intel RealSense camera for facial recognition via Windows Hello.  

The 23.8inch HP Pavilion All-In-One will arrive on July 10th starting at $699.99 and the 27inch is set to arrive on July 3rd starting at $999.99
